How regenerative agriculture is building farmers' resilience to climate change

28 March 2023

Mary used to plant seeds from her previous harvests and only used a little fertiliser or manure. These practices depleted the soil’s nutrients, leaving the mother of four struggling financially. After joining Farm Africa’s Regenerative Agriculture project, she is now a village-based advisor, teaching other farmers how to increase their harvest with her newly taught methods.

Cultivate programme propels Tanzanian agri-business to enter the export market

09 March 2023

Business training from Farm Africa's Cultivate programme has helped Mr Said's sunflower processing business in Tanzania to thrive. The guidance by Farm Africa staff has helped the company to qualify for finance to help their business grow and triple the staff numbers.
